Morgenschtean (Subtitle: Die Österreichische Dialektzeitschrift ) is an Austrian literary magazine from Vienna .
The magazine has been published since 1989 and appears quarterly. Unpublished poems , short prose texts , dramatic scenes and reviews can be found on a length of 60 to 100 pages . The circulation is 300 to 500 pieces. Morgenschtean is the most important journal for dialect literature in Austria. The authors published so far include:
